Pilih Laman




Bangun Website IoT Impian Anda Sekarang!


Website IoT

Bangun Website IoT Impian Anda Sekarang!

Eh, teman-teman! Pernah gak sih kepikiran buat ngontrol lampu rumah dari jarak jauh? Atau pengen tahu suhu kulkas tanpa harus buka pintunya? Nah, itu semua bisa diwujudin lewat yang namanya IoT alias Internet of Things. Keren kan?

Tapi, bentar… sebelum kita jauh mikirin kulkas pintar, ada satu masalah yang sering banget bikin orang pusing: Gimana cara bikin website buat ngontrol semua alat IoT itu?

Bener gak? Mikirnya aja udah bikin mumet. Tapi tenang, bro! Gue hadir di sini bukan buat bikin kamu tambah pusing, tapi buat ngasih solusi yang simpel, jelas, dan pastinya bikin kamu langsung pengen nyobain.

Siap? Mari kita mulai!

Kenapa Website IoT Itu Penting Banget?

Oke, sebelum kita ngoding, penting buat tahu kenapa sih website IoT itu penting? Bayangin gini deh:

  • Kontrol Terpusat: Kamu bisa ngontrol semua perangkat IoT kamu dari satu tempat. Gak perlu lagi ribet buka aplikasi satu per satu.
  • Monitoring Jarak Jauh: Mau tahu kondisi rumah saat lagi liburan? Tinggal buka website, langsung kelihatan semua datanya. Asik!
  • Automatisasi: Website bisa diatur buat otomatisasi tugas tertentu. Misalnya, lampu otomatis nyala saat matahari terbenam. Praktis abis!
  • Analisis Data: Data dari perangkat IoT bisa diolah jadi informasi yang berguna. Misalnya, kamu bisa tahu kapan pemakaian listrik paling tinggi di rumah kamu.

Intinya, website IoT itu kayak pusat kendali buat semua “mainan” pintar kamu. Makin canggih, makin seru!

Langkah-Langkah Super Simpel Bikin Website IoT

Oke, sekarang kita masuk ke inti dari semua ini: gimana caranya bikin website IoT yang kece badai?

1. Pilih Platform yang Pas Buat Kamu (Jangan Bikin Pusing!)

Nah, ini penting banget. Ada banyak platform yang bisa kamu pake, tapi jangan sampai salah pilih ya. Gue saranin, buat pemula, mending pilih yang gampang dulu. Beberapa opsi yang oke:

  • Node-RED: Ini mah udah kayak LEGO-nya IoT. Gampang banget dipake, tinggal drag and drop, terus jadi deh. Cocok buat yang gak terlalu jago ngoding.
  • ThingSpeak: Platform gratis dari MathWorks (yang bikin MATLAB). Fokusnya ke pengumpulan dan visualisasi data. Lumayan oke buat yang pengen ngulik data.
  • Firebase: Punya Google, jadi udah pasti keren. Fiturnya lengkap, mulai dari database, authentication, sampe hosting. Cocok buat yang pengen bikin aplikasi IoT yang kompleks.

Contoh Nyata: Anggap aja kamu mau bikin website buat nampilin suhu dan kelembapan dari sensor DHT11. Kalo pake Node-RED, kamu tinggal cari node DHT11, terus hubungin ke node chart. Gampang banget kan?

2. Siapin “Otak” Buat Website Kamu (Server atau Cloud?)

Website butuh “otak” buat mikir, alias server. Nah, ada dua pilihan:

  • Server Lokal: Kamu bisa pake komputer di rumah kamu sebagai server. Keuntungannya, gratis (kecuali listrik ya). Tapi, ya gitu deh, harus nyala terus komputernya.
  • Cloud Server: Ini lebih praktis. Kamu sewa server di internet. Keuntungannya, website kamu bisa diakses dari mana aja, kapan aja. Tapi, ya bayar bulanan.

Pilihan Populer: Buat cloud server, kamu bisa coba Heroku, AWS (Amazon Web Services), atau Google Cloud Platform. Banyak tutorial gratis kok di internet.

Tips Jitu: Kalo masih belajar, mending pake server lokal dulu aja. Nanti kalo udah jago, baru deh migrasi ke cloud.

3. Desain Tampilan Website yang Kece (Biar Gak Bosenin!)

Tampilan website itu penting banget. Ibaratnya, kalo makanannya enak tapi penyajiannya jelek, kan jadi kurang nafsu. Sama kayak website, kalo isinya bagus tapi tampilannya berantakan, ya orang males lihat.

  • CSS Framework: Pake CSS framework kayak Bootstrap atau Tailwind CSS. Ini bakal bikin tampilan website kamu jadi lebih rapi dan responsif (bisa menyesuaikan ukuran layar).
  • Template Gratis: Banyak banget template website gratis di internet. Tinggal cari yang sesuai sama selera kamu, terus edit deh.
  • Warna yang Cocok: Pilih warna yang enak dilihat dan sesuai sama tema IoT kamu. Misalnya, warna biru atau hijau sering diasosiasikan dengan teknologi.

Contoh Desain: Bayangin kamu mau bikin website buat nampilin data sensor. Kamu bisa bikin grafik yang interaktif, terus tambahin tombol buat ngontrol perangkat IoT kamu. Keren kan?

4. Hubungin Website Kamu ke Perangkat IoT (Ini Bagian Serunya!)

Nah, ini dia bagian yang paling seru: menghubungkan website kamu ke perangkat IoT. Ada beberapa cara buat ngelakuin ini:

  • MQTT (Message Queuing Telemetry Transport): Protokol yang ringan dan cocok buat komunikasi IoT. Banyak library MQTT yang tersedia buat berbagai bahasa pemrograman.
  • HTTP API: Kalo perangkat IoT kamu punya API, kamu bisa pake HTTP request buat ngirim dan nerima data.
  • WebSockets: Buat komunikasi real-time antara website dan perangkat IoT. Cocok buat aplikasi yang butuh update data secara instan.

Contoh Implementasi: Anggap aja kamu pake Raspberry Pi buat ngontrol lampu. Kamu bisa install library MQTT di Raspberry Pi, terus kirim pesan MQTT ke website kamu setiap kali ada perubahan status lampu. Di website, kamu tinggal dengerin pesan MQTT, terus update tampilan website sesuai sama status lampu.

5. Uji Coba dan Debugging (Jangan Panik Kalo Ada Error!)

Setelah semua langkah di atas selesai, jangan langsung seneng dulu. Kamu perlu uji coba website kamu buat mastiin semuanya berjalan lancar. Kalo ada error, jangan panik! Cari tahu penyebabnya, terus perbaiki. Inget, semua programmer pernah ngalamin error kok.

Tips Debugging:

  • Console Log: Pake console log buat nampilin pesan debugging di browser kamu. Ini bakal bantu kamu buat tahu apa yang terjadi di balik layar.
  • DevTools: Pake DevTools di browser kamu buat ngecek network request, element HTML, dan lain-lain.
  • Google is Your Best Friend: Kalo stuck, jangan ragu buat nanya ke Google. Dijamin, ada banyak banget orang yang pernah ngalamin masalah yang sama kayak kamu.

Tips Tambahan Biar Website IoT Kamu Makin Keren

Oke, ini beberapa tips tambahan biar website IoT kamu makin kece badai:

  • Keamanan: Pastiin website kamu aman dari serangan hacker. Pake password yang kuat, enkripsi data, dan lain-lain.
  • Responsif: Bikin website kamu responsif, biar bisa diakses dengan nyaman dari berbagai perangkat (komputer, tablet, smartphone).
  • User-Friendly: Bikin website kamu mudah digunakan. Jangan bikin user bingung gara-gara navigasi yang ribet.
  • Dokumentasi: Buat dokumentasi yang jelas tentang website kamu. Ini bakal bantu kamu buat maintenance dan update website di masa depan.

Kesimpulan: Saatnya Bangun Website IoT Impianmu!

Gimana, teman-teman? Udah gak pusing lagi kan mikirin cara bikin website IoT? Intinya, jangan takut buat nyoba! Mulai dari yang simpel dulu, terus pelan-pelan ditingkatin. Dijamin, lama-lama kamu bakal jago!

Jadi, inget ya, kita udah bongkar semua rahasia bikin website IoT yang keren. Mulai dari milih platform yang cocok, nyiapin server, desain tampilan yang kece, sampe cara nyambungin ke perangkat IoT. Jangan lupa juga buat uji coba dan debugging biar website kamu bener-bener sempurna.

Sekarang, waktunya kamu gercep! Jangan cuma dibaca doang artikel ini. Langsung aja bikin akun di salah satu platform IoT yang udah kita bahas (Node-RED, ThingSpeak, atau Firebase) dan mulai utak-atik! Buat project sederhana dulu, misalnya nampilin data suhu dari sensor DHT11. Abis itu, share hasilnya di media sosial dan tag kita ya! Kita pengen banget lihat karya keren kamu.

Inget, semua hal besar dimulai dari langkah kecil. Jangan takut buat salah, jangan takut buat gagal. Justru dari kesalahan itulah kita belajar dan berkembang. Ayo, keluarkan kreativitasmu dan wujudkan website IoT impianmu sekarang juga! Siapa tahu, website kamu bisa jadi inspirasi buat orang lain. Semangat terus, teman-teman! Karena masa depan ada di tanganmu, dan sekarang, website IoT juga ada di tanganmu!

Oh iya, satu lagi… kira-kira, inovasi IoT apa nih yang pengen banget kamu wujudin lewat website? Share dong di kolom komentar!